Remember as well, he was a Larke medal winner, and going back to 2000 there have been very few duds amongst those. Very few slipped past the first round with most going top 5. Disregarding those that are still playing, very few didn't play 100+ games.

Year/Name/Draft Pick/Games Played
2018 Sam Walsh #1 National 2018 3
2017 Oscar Allen #21 National 2017 5
2016 Jack Graham #53 National 2016 26
2015 Josh Schache #2 National 2015 43
2014 Christian Petracca #2 National 2014 66
2013 Dom Sheed #11 National 2013 81
2012 Lachie Whitfield #1 National 2012 117
2011 Stephen Coniglio #2 National 2011 121
2010 Harley Bennell #2 National 2010 83
2009 David Swallow #1 National 2010 120
2009 Andrew Hooper #35 Rookie 2009 7
2008 Jack Watts #1 National 2008 174
2007 Cale Morton #4 National 2007 76
2006 Tom Hawkins #41 National 2006 235
2005 Marc Murphy #1 National 2005 252
2004 Jesse Smith #42 National 2004 27
2003 Kepler Bradley #6 National 2003 117
2002 Byron Schammer #13 National 2002 129
2001 Steven Armstrong #25 National 2001 79
2001 Sam Power #10 National 2001 123
2000 Kayne Pettifer #9 National 2000 113
